We handle the hard stuff. Even a seemingly minor crash can lead to major medical bills and missed time at work. We step in to make sure the insurance company takes your injuries seriously and covers the true cost of your accident. We fight to help you recover compensation for:

Medical Expenses
Covering hospital stays, physical therapy, medications, and any future care you might need.

Lost Wages
Making up for the paychecks you missed while recovering, as well as reduced future earning capacity.

Pain and Suffering
Compensation for the physical pain and emotional distress caused by the crash.

Property Damage
Getting your vehicle repaired or replaced so you can get back on the road.
What to do right now. If you were just in an accident, your health and safety are the absolute priorities. Here is exactly what you need to do to protect yourself and your claim:
See a doctor immediately, even if you feel fine. Adrenaline can hide pain, and getting a medical evaluation on record is crucial for your health and your case.
Take clear photos of the vehicle damage, the road conditions, and any visible injuries. Keep every medical bill, discharge paper, and receipt.
Even for a minor fender bender, having an official police report on file is a vital piece of evidence.
Insurance adjusters are trained to get you to say things that can hurt your case. Don't sign anything or give a recorded statement until you know your options. Let us handle the communication.
